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Eggplant

    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Cut the eggplant into cubes, toss with olive oil, salt, and pepper. Spread on a baking sheet and roast for 25-30 minutes until tender.

  2. 2

    Make the Meatball Mixture

    In a large bowl, combine the roasted eggplant, breadcrumbs, parmesan cheese, chopped fresh basil, minced garlic, egg,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.

  3. 3

    Form the Meatballs

    Using your hands, form the mixture into meatballs, about 1.5 inches in diameter. Place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.

  4. 4

    Bake the Meatballs

    Bake the meatballs in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until they are golden brown.

  5. 5

    Prepare the Basil Pomodoro Sauce

    In a saucepan,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add crushed tomatoes, sugar, salt, and pepper. Simmer for 15-20 minutes. Stir in chopped fresh basil just before serving.

  6. 6

    Cook the Spaghetti

    While the meatballs are baking, cook the spaghetti according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.

  7. 7

    Serve

    Serve the spaghetti topped with the eggplant meatballs and basil pomodoro sauce. Garnish with additional basil and parmesan cheese if desired.
